    Fantasy life!

    I forgot how good this game was tbh. It has a cartoonish style, but the mechanics are super cool! You 12 "life's" or jobs that you can choose from at the beginning from miner and tailor to hunter and paladin and each additional life you take on after the first helps you with every other life! Gather your own ore to use as a blacksmith to make the weapons you use as a Paladin. everything is connected and the story is not half bad either. The DLC allows you to grow even further

    -Any of the Fallout or Elder Scrolls games. Bethesda has many flaws as a developer, and so do their games. But one thing they always manage to absolutely slay is open-world exploration. Discovering and learning about their carefully crafted worlds at your own pace is the best part of any of these games.

    -Bloodborne. Challenging, beautiful, and horrific. This game is nearly flawless on all counts and is an absolute adrenaline rush to play.

    -Dragon's Dogma: Dark Arisen (please catch me on Steam if you do ever play this, I want to rent out my pawn to people!) Amazing combat. Solid storytelling. Not so great in the open-world department, but there's a charm to this game nonetheless, with its character customization. Bitterblack Isle is the best part of this game! As an added bonus, this game contains the best dragon-cenctric boss fight of all time. Grigori makes Alduin look like a flat cardboard cutout.

    -Monster Hunter: World. If you haven't already, get this game. You won't regret seeing one of the most beautifully crafted worlds in modern gaming, with its highly detailed ecosystem and interesting semi-realistic approach to monsters as giant animals. The combat is buttery smooth and weighty. A bit of a learning curve, though.

    Iggy's Egg Adventure, is a cute platformer game where you play as a baby raptor with the ability to unlock and play as other dinosaurs too as you set out to save Iggy's mother. The game is harder than it looks, for me at least, there's also a time attack mode for those that like to go fast. You can collect eggs, unlock skins for the characters and earn achievements.

    The mainline Shin Megami Tensei series. They aren’t as accessible as the Persona titles, but don’t let that scare you. Behind the difficulty is a well written, fleshed out JRPG series full of atmosphere and personality. If you enjoy the Persona games or JRPGs at all, consider these games!

    Ever Oasis on 3ds. Its one of the most underappreciated games on the system, combining aspects of Zelda and Animal Crossing with a gorgeous Egyptian aesthetic. Its on the easy side, but that doesn't stop me from giving it a high recommendation.
